OFFICIAL: UCL will return on Aug 7 as 'Final 8' will be held in Lisbon on Aug 12

UEFA have today confirmed plans to finish this season's Champions League with a mini-tournament in Lisbon over 12 days in August.

OFFICIAL: All original cities will host EURO 2020 from 11 June to 11 July 2021

UEFA announced on Wednesday that it was planning to keep the same pan-continental format for the postponed Euro 2020 which will start from 11 June to 11 July 2021 after president Aleksander Ceferin recently hinted that the number of host cities could be reduced. 

OFFICIAL: 4 different German cities to host UEL in 11 days with final in Cologne

UEFA have confirmed plans to finish the Europa League across four different German cities over 11 days, with the final to be held in Cologne on August 21.

Oblak reaches 100 clean sheets in just 182 La Liga games

Oblak kept his 100th clean sheet in LaLiga on Wednesday. He’s done so in just 182 games, fewer than any other shotstopper in the history of the competition.
